The Opportunity
The role of a Lead Engineer is to work across the systems, software, and hardware domains to manage the activities which support certification of the product(s) and realise the results, delivering evidence to support critical deliveries to customers. You will be expected to be involved in requirements capture and verification activities as well as supporting the resolution of queries from customers and other areas of the business.
This is a varied and exciting role, which includes development of test procedures against systems & software requirements, contributing to requirements definition and fault finding, creation of test strategies, operating within laboratories with the hardware and test systems, supporting the acceptance and certification of the product, stakeholder management, and ensuring technical publications are valid.
As a Lead Engineer, your main responsibilities will include:
-
Understand and perform the verification stages of the design lifecycle, defining clear test procedures and strategies.
-
Work within a multi-discipline engineering team (e.g. Systems, mechanical, electrical, software etc…).
-
Log and track defects found during V&V activities and resulting from customer queries, collaborating with development teams to resolve them.
-
Own tasks and deliver results, managing schedule, cost, quality and performance metrics for assigned work packages.
-
Working with the Head of LMS, LMS Architect, and LMS verification teams, use DOORS and IBM Rhapsody (and similar engineering requirements capture tools) to manage requirements, verification scenarios, test procedures, and evidence collection.
-
Work within a laboratory environment with software, Test Equipment, and the electronic equipment under test.
